3.3.11. Ensure safe working position, always keep your balance.
3.3.12. Keep your machine always clean for safe operation. Follow the instructions at
maintenance and replacement of accessories. Check the plug and cable regularly.
If damaged, let it replace by a qualified electrician. Keep handles and grips free of
any oil and grease.
3.3.13. Unplug first, before conducting and maintenance works.
3.3.14. Ensure that any keys or adjustment tools have been removed before
operating the machine.
3.3.15. If you are required to operate the machine outside, use only appropriate
extension cables.
3.3.16. Repairs should be carried out by qualified technicians only. Otherwise,
accidents may occur.
3.3.17. Before starting a new operation, check the appropriate function of
protective devices and tools, ensure that they work properly. All conditions have to
be fulfilled in order to ensure proper operation of your machine. Damaged
protective parts and equipment have to be replaced or repaired properly (by the
manufacturer or dealer).
3.3.18. Don’t use machines with improper functioning buttons and switches.
3.3.19. Don’t keep flammable, combustive liquids and materials next to the machine and
electric connections.
4. TRANSPORT OF THE MACHINE
The transport should be done by qualified personnel only.
The machine should be transported by lifting with proper equipment (not touching the
ground during the transport).
Don’t lift the machine before ensuring that lifting devices or other equipment is placed
properly under the machine.
5. INSTALLATION OF THE MACHINE
The machine should be located at least 50 cm away from the back wall in order to
enable full opening of the upper cover to the back, and to carry out maintenance and
cleaning works on the machine. For the distance to be left on the left and right side of the
machine see Figure-6 and Dimensions.
